Citizen With Pride:
In a resent publication of the GO Guide I was asked to share who my favorite LGBT Icon was and way.
You will find no greater fan of Mayor Richard Daley than I am, so I submitted the following:
"Since being voted in as the 54th mayor of Chicago in 1989, Mayor Daley has been a stalwart advocate of LGBT people. He has shown time and time again his compassion and belief in our community. The evidence of this dedication is everywhere! From the rainbow pylons throughout Boystown to his embracing of the 2006 Gay Games, Mayor Daley continues to be one of the community's greatest friends."
Last night he proved me right at the City of Chicago Commission on Human Relations' Advisory Council on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ual and Transgender Issues in celebration of Pride Month. His speech was out of this world and from the heart!
I am BEYOND Proud to be a citizen of Chicago under his leadership!

Art Johnson Is My Hero!:
For those of you Chicago folks who’ve seen WTTW channel eleven’s special documentary on the history of Chicago’s Lesbian, Gay, Bi-Sexual and Transgender community called Out & Proud In Chicago you know the name of Sidetracks co-owner, Art Johnson. His recant of the challenging times in the LGBT community made me cry. It was especially nice to see him so happy at the party! (Note: Out & Proud In Chicago is scheduled for one more showing on June 15th at 6:00 PM.
